- (continued from previous page)house one of them looked behind the door and say the notice -
Father 144 years-
Mother 39 years
Three sons aged 11 years 9 years and 6 years
He immediately raised the alarm and the officer ordered a search for the man 144 years of age having three children aged 11, 9 and 6. He was eventually found hiding under the bed and when he was brought out he explained the case to them and the British enjoying the joke gave him his liberty, while some of the boys who planned it were stripped to the shirt filling the trench. - You are not logged in, but you are welcome to contribute a transcription anonymously.
